Recognizing Cataract Surgery Process



Exploring the actions involved in cataract surgery can aid alleviate any kind of stress and anxiety or unpredictability you may have concerning the treatment. Cataract surgical procedure is a typical and very successful treatment that includes getting rid of the over cast lens in your eye and changing it with a clear man-made lens.

Before the surgery, your eye will certainly be numbed with eye declines or an injection to guarantee you do not feel any kind of pain during the procedure. The surgeon will certainly make a little cut in your eye to access the cataract and break it up utilizing ultrasound waves prior to meticulously removing it.

Once go to the website is eliminated, the synthetic lens will certainly be placed in its area. The entire surgical procedure generally takes about 15-30 mins per eye and is normally done one eye at a time.

After the surgical procedure, you might experience some mild discomfort or blurred vision, yet this is regular and ought to enhance as your eye heals.

Post-Operative Treatment Tips



After cataract surgical treatment, providing proper post-operative care is vital for your liked one's recuperation. Guarantee they use the safety shield over their eye as advised by the medical professional. Help them carry out suggested eye drops and medicines promptly to prevent infection and aid healing.

Encourage your enjoyed one to stay clear of touching or rubbing their eyes, as this can lead to problems. Assist them in following any type of restrictions on flexing, lifting heavy things, or taking part in laborious tasks to stop stress on the eyes. Ensure they go to all follow-up consultations with the eye physician for keeping track of progression.



Maintain the eye location clean and dry, preventing water or soap directly in the eyes. Motivate your loved one to wear sunglasses to shield their eyes from bright light and glow during the healing process. Hold your horses and encouraging as they recover, using aid with day-to-day tasks as needed.
